Arend-jan Tetteroo is a seasoned software engineer with 15 years of experience building web applications, information dashboards, and SaaS platforms from concept to production. He co-founded The Green Web Foundation and has a long track record of applying web technology to promote transparency and sustainability, including building the Greencheck API and browser extensions. Currently at TactiPlan and running his own freelance practice, he combines hands-on full-stack development with product thinking gained as a former lead developer and product manager. He is equally comfortable leading teams and shipping code, with strengths in backend architectures, reporting tools, and pragmatic integrations. Outside tech he channels leadership and coaching skills into kayaking clubs and training, an unusual crossover that informs his collaborative, discipline-driven approach.
